Welcome aboard! By using Desk together with Teamwork.com enables you to keep your communication with clients together with where you do your project work.

There are a few ways you can do this:
- You can forward emails from Gsuite by following the steps here: https://support.teamwork.com/desk/integrations/using-g-suite-to-forward-emails

- Use Gmail (or another email client) to create inboxes which you can then connect via oauth with Desk. This would require licenses in Gmail. This enables you to keep email addresses with your domain and gives you more control over how emails are sent - you can choose to send via your own server, or send with Teamwork's server.
- Or, you can create a Teamwork inbox. This allows you to quickly set up an "email address" which you can give out to clients and will create tickets directly in that inbox. This will create an inbox with atyourdomain.teamwork.com. You wont have the option to send with your own server here, only send using Teamwork's server.
